Exploring Chromium and Magnesium's Role in Blood Sugar Control
Chromium and magnesium are two essential minerals that play crucial roles in the regulation of blood sugar levels. Chromium improves the effectiveness of insulin, facilitating enhanced glucose uptake by cells, while magnesium aids in increasing insulin sensitivity. Including these minerals through nutritional supplements for diabetic athletes can help maintain stable blood sugar levels, thereby boosting athletic performance and recovery times. By ensuring adequate intake of these essential minerals, athletes can support their metabolic health and encourage optimal performance.
The Significant Health Benefits of Cinnamon Extract for Diabetes Management

Cinnamon extract has gained considerable attention for its ability to lower blood sugar levels and enhance insulin sensitivity. The bioactive compounds present in cinnamon can mimic insulin, leading to improved glucose metabolism. For diabetic athletes, integrating cinnamon extract into their supplement routine can provide a natural and effective method of regulating blood sugar, making it an invaluable addition to the recommended nutritional supplements. This natural supplement can contribute to enhanced metabolic health and improved athletic performance.
Improving Blood Sugar Regulation with Alpha-Lipoic Acid
Alpha-lipoic acid serves as a potent antioxidant, playing a vital role in glucose metabolism. It enhances insulin sensitivity and may help mitigate oxidative stress associated with diabetes. By incorporating alpha-lipoic acid into their supplementation plans, diabetic athletes can better manage their blood sugar levels while promoting overall health and athletic performance. This antioxidant not only supports metabolic function but also aids in recovery, making it an essential element of any athlete's nutritional strategy.

Boosting Endurance with the Advantages of Beta-Alanine
Beta-alanine is famous for its ability to enhance endurance by buffering lactic acid build-up in muscles. Diabetic athletes can experience considerable benefits from this supplement, especially during extended physical exertion. By delaying the onset of fatigue, beta-alanine allows athletes to maintain a higher level of intensity, ultimately resulting in enhanced performance. Its strategic inclusion in nutritional supplements for diabetic athletes can lead to significant improvements in endurance and overall athletic output.

Supporting Bone Health with Vitamin D for Athletes
Vitamin D is vital for maintaining bone health, especially for athletes who put significant stress on their skeletal systems. Diabetic individuals often have lower vitamin D levels, making supplementation crucial. Adequate vitamin D promotes calcium absorption and strengthens bone density, reducing the risk of fractures and injuries. Consequently, it is a key component of nutritional supplements for diabetic athletes, ensuring they remain robust and injury-free.

Clarifying Misconceptions About Sugar-Free Supplements
A prevalent myth among athletes is that sugar-free supplements are inherently safe for individuals with diabetes. However, “sugar-free” does not automatically equate to healthfulness or effectiveness. Certain sugar substitutes can still induce insulin spikes or adversely affect gut health. Athletes must scrutinise ingredient lists and select nutritional supplements for diabetic athletes that align with their health objectives to ensure safety and efficacy.

Frequently Asked Questions About Nutritional Supplements for Diabetic Athletes
Can Supplements Replace Diabetes Medication?
Supplements should never be regarded as a substitute for prescribed diabetes medications. However, when used alongside medical treatments, they can support overall health and assist in effectively managing blood sugar levels.
Are There Possible Side Effects Associated with Supplements?
While many supplements are generally safe, some may result in side effects or interact with medications. It is crucial to consult with a healthcare provider before commencing any new supplement to ensure safety and efficacy.
How Can One Identify High-Quality Supplements?
Seek out supplements that are third-party tested, feature clear labelling, and utilise high-quality ingredients. Research reputable brands and read consumer reviews to make informed choices that align with health objectives.
What Should Be Done If Blood Sugar Levels Spike?
In the event of a blood sugar spike, it is vital to monitor levels closely and consult with a healthcare provider. Adjustments to diet, exercise, or supplements may be necessary to effectively manage these fluctuations and maintain optimal health.
